FTS: REYNATIS Demo Now Available on PlayStation, Switch, and Steam



REYNATIS Demo is Available Now on PlayStation, Switch, and Steam

Sept. 13, 2024 | We are thrilled to announce that the demo for the highly anticipated action RPG REYNATIS is now available on PlayStation 4|5, Nintendo Switch, and Steam! Get a taste of this dark urban fantasy by diving into the opening chapters and experiencing the dual perspectives of main characters Marin Kirizumi and Sari Nishijima.



Meet the Characters

Marin Kirizumi
Marin is a 19-year-old college student who discovered his magical abilities at the age of 14 after a near-fatal car accident. Since then, he has lived under constant oppression due to his status as a wizard. Determined to gain his freedom, Marin aims to become the “strongest wizard that no one can defeat.” His journey leads him to Shibuya, guided by the words left behind by his father.

Sari Nishijima
Once a police officer, Sari was gravely injured by a monster in Shibuya in the spring of 2021. On the brink of death, she awakened as a replica and soon joined the M.E.A. Now, she serves as an officer in the M.E.A.'s Magic Task Force. Despite the organization’s attempts to use her image for recruitment, Sari resists this role.


REYNATIS is an atmospheric urban fantasy set in a meticulously recreated Shibuya, Tokyo. The game explores the ultimate clash between magic and order. As Marin seeks freedom through strength, he encounters Sari, an officer of the M.E.A., an organization dedicated to controlling wizards.

1More SonoFlow Headphones HQ51... Reviewed!


The 1More Sonoflow HQ51 (also known as... 1More SonoFlow Pro) over-ear headphones are a sweet choice for audiophiles and casual listeners alike. With a combination of high-quality sound, exceptional comfort, and impressive features, these headphones offer excellent value for the money. I know because I've been here before with the first gen SonoFlow headphones, but... are these better? Well, let's check out the specs... after this unboxing!




Quality & Comfort


Right off the bat... you get comfortable padding in all the right places. The padding on the headband is soft and durable and you won't feel the housing. The other obvious area where you will find the padding are the left and right ear pads on the swivel and foldable earcups. The yokes of these headphones are sturdy, and have actually lasted longer than headphones that cost hundreds more. I won't say names, but... yeah, these swivel and foldable headphones have solid yokes that connect to a thicker section that you adjust on the headband.



I don't want to overlook the buttons either, they don't wiggle or feel loose. The buttons are solid, clicky, and responsive. They're spaced out and easy to identify. The upper button in the back of the right earcup is the ANC button, the two below are Vol+/Vol-, and the button in the front of the right earcup is the power button. I'm not seeing a difference in regards to the quality and comfort of the original SonoFlow and the  HQ51's, but... that's not a bad thing. If it ain't broke... don't try to fix it.


The only thing i'm not a big fan of is the change in the interior of the headphone case. I figure it was a manufacturing decision, but I like that secure fit of the original case. The exterior of the case is similar to the original, which is great... so at least it gets a win on that note.


Specs and Features

  • QuietMax AI Noise Cancellation: Effectively tunes out background noise, enhancing your audio experience. 42+dB noise cancellation using QuietMax.

    By the way, the HQ51's have a deeper noise reduction depth than the Bose NC700's. They dance for dominance, but... the winner is the winner.


  • Tuned by Grammy-Winning Sound Engineer: Ensures top-notch sound quality.
  • Fast Charge: Provides 10 hours of battery life from just 5 minutes of charging.

    Let me say this: I haven't charged these headphones yet. I've used them for a little over a week and even forgot to turn them off one day, and they're still going. 
  • Battery Life: Up to 100 hours on a full charge after 80 minutes with the HQ51. You still get 65 hours of battery life with ANC on.

    You get 70 hours on a full charge with the original SonoFlow headphones. Regardless of long battery, remember to give your ears a break, especially when it comes to listening at certain decibles.
  • 40mm DLC Dynamic Driver: Delivers rich, detailed sound.
  • 12 Studio-Grade EQs: Customizable sound settings, with the “Studio” setting being particularly impressive.
  • Wired and Bluetooth 5.4 Wireless Modes: Offers flexibility in connectivity.

    The original SonoFlow's have Bluetooth 5.0.
  • Comfort: High comfort level with no extreme pressure on the ears, making it suitable for long listening sessions. However, it’s best used in a cool setting to avoid sweating around the ears so you can truly appreciate the material.


Audio Performance

The SonoFlow HQ51 contains a 40mm Dynamic Driver. The diamond-like carbon composite diaphragm matches up with aluminum's material density, but... when it comes to resonance frequency, sound conduction, and thermal conductivity, that's all the DLC in these HQ51's. By the way, these headphones have dual hi-res gold certification. On a side note, I wasn't planning on making a left turn to speak on the headphones of other brands, but... the Total Harmonic Distortion (THD) in the HQ51's is better than Sony's XM5s. High THD can lead to audible distortion that can deliver an unnatural sound. I don't want to crap on the XM5s because they're solid, and run a close race to some extent but... the HQ51's are better. What is Hi-Res Audio?


Hi-Res Audio refers to audio files that have a higher sampling frequency and bit depth than CD quality. This means more detail and a more accurate representation of the original recording (it will sound more on the lines of what you would hear in the studio if you were there).


What is Hi-Res Audio Wireless?

For audio to qualify as Hi-Res Audio Wireless, it must meet certain standards set by the Japan Audio Society (JAS). This includes using codecs like LDAC or aptX HD that can transmit audio at higher bit rates, ensuring minimal loss in quality during wireless transmission.

Technical Specifications

  • Speaker Impedance: 32 ohms, which means the headphones can be driven by most portable devices without requiring an external amplifier.
  • Bluetooth Protocol: Supports HFP, A2DP, and AVRCP for versatile connectivity.
  • Frequency Band: 2.400 GHz - 2.4835 GHz.
  • Bluetooth Range: Up to 10 meters in open space.
